如何实现AI语音开发中的语音情感交互?
在人工智能技术飞速发展的今天,语音交互已经成为人们日常生活中不可或缺的一部分。从智能家居到智能手机,从车载系统到客服机器人,语音情感交互逐渐成为提高用户体验的关键。那么,如何实现AI语音开发中的语音情感交互呢?让我们通过一个故事来了解一下。
故事的主人公叫李明,是一位年轻的AI语音工程师。他热衷于研究语音情感交互技术,希望通过自己的努力,让AI能够更好地理解和满足人们的需求。
李明所在的公司是一家专注于人工智能语音技术的企业。他们正在研发一款面向大众的智能语音助手,旨在为用户提供便捷、贴心的服务。然而,在初期测试中,智能语音助手的表现并不理想。尽管能够完成基本的指令任务,但在与用户的互动过程中,缺乏情感共鸣,让用户感觉如同与一台冰冷的机器交流。
为了解决这个问题,李明决定深入研究语音情感交互技术。他首先从了解人类情感表达开始,查阅了大量关于心理学、语言学和计算机科学的文献。他发现,人类情感表达主要分为两种:言语情感和非言语情感。
言语情感主要表现为语气、语调、语速、停顿等语言特征;而非言语情感则包括面部表情、肢体动作、眼神交流等。在AI语音开发中,实现语音情感交互,就需要让AI能够识别并模仿这些情感表达。
接下来,李明开始研究如何让AI识别用户的情感。他了解到,目前常用的情感识别方法有基于规则、基于统计和基于深度学习三种。基于规则的方法主要依靠人工编写规则来判断情感,但这种方法难以覆盖所有情况,适用性有限。基于统计的方法则通过分析语料库中的数据,找出情感表达的规律,但这种方法对数据量要求较高,且容易受到噪声干扰。
于是,李明决定尝试基于深度学习的方法。他利用大量标注了情感标签的语料库,训练了一个情感识别模型。经过多次优化,模型在识别情感方面的准确率得到了显著提升。然而,仅仅识别情感还不足以实现语音情感交互,还需要让AI能够根据识别到的情感调整自己的语气、语调等表达方式。
为了实现这一目标,李明开始研究语音合成技术。他了解到,目前常用的语音合成方法有合成语音和合成语调两种。合成语音主要是通过改变音素、音节和音调等参数来生成语音,而合成语调则是通过调整语音的节奏、强弱等参数来表现情感。
在深入研究的基础上,李明设计了一套基于合成语调的语音情感交互方案。他首先让AI根据识别到的情感,选择合适的情感模板;然后,根据模板调整语音的节奏、强弱等参数,最终生成具有相应情感的语音。
经过一番努力,李明的方案在测试中取得了良好的效果。智能语音助手在与用户的互动过程中,能够根据用户的情感调整自己的语气、语调,让用户感受到更加贴心的服务。例如,当用户表达出沮丧情绪时,智能语音助手会放慢语速,降低音量,用温柔的语气安慰用户;而当用户表达出喜悦情绪时,智能语音助手则会提高语速,增强音量,用欢快的语气回应用户。
随着李明研究的深入,他的方案逐渐得到了业界的认可。越来越多的企业开始关注语音情感交互技术,并将其应用于自己的产品中。李明也因其卓越的成果,成为了该领域的佼佼者。
然而,李明并没有因此而满足。他知道,语音情感交互技术还有很大的发展空间。为了进一步提升用户体验,他开始研究如何让AI更好地理解用户的语境和意图。他希望通过自己的努力,让AI在语音情感交互方面取得更大的突破,为人们创造更加美好的生活。
这个故事告诉我们,实现AI语音开发中的语音情感交互并非易事,需要工程师们深入研究心理学、语言学和计算机科学等多个领域。但只要我们坚持不懈,勇于创新,就一定能够让AI更好地服务于人类,为我们的生活带来更多美好。
猜你喜欢:AI客服